To the question, How could Moss never have won the WDC? I think the
best answer is times had changed, and his romantic self run show, did
not fit with the factory teams. They wanted a driver who would be loyal
to the team and to them. Jack Brabham was loyal to John Cooper and to
Cooper cars. Both Phil Hill and Von Tripps were loyal to Ferrari.
Graham Hill was loyal to BRM. Colin Chapman finally found Jim Clark
who would be loyal. Stirling Moss was smart, but way too often thought
he was better at every decision, than any team could be. He had
alienated every team owner/manager. From 1957 on, he never drove the
same make of car for the full season. Also, he put too much importance
on winning and not enough on scoring WDC points with a 2nd or a 3rd.
